![]() ![]() If the header is too large, a stack-based overflow results. It creates a listener on TCP port 27700, and when a connection is made the Modbus Application Header is read into a buffer, the ICS-CERT advisory said. ![]() The driver is started when a programmable logic controller is connected to the serial port on a server. ![]() The Industrial Control Systems Computer Emergency Response Team (ICS-CERT) released an advisory yesterday alerting users to the availability of a patch and warning of the consequences associated with the st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ability found in Schneider’s Serial Modbus Driver, ModbusDrv.exe. Schneider Electric, a leading provider of industrial control systems, recently patched a remotely exploitable vulnerability in a driver found in 11 of its products.
